The SAK-C167CS-L33M CA is a 16-bit microcontroller from Infineon Technologies belonging to the C166 family. This microcontroller is designed for embedded control applications, offering a combination of processing power, integrated peripherals, and real-time capabilities.
Applications
- Industrial automation systems
- Automotive control (e.g., engine management, transmission control)
- Motor control applications
- Power supply control
- Robotics
Features
- 16-bit CPU architecture
- Internal RAM for data storage
- Clock frequency up to 33 MHz
- Multiple timers and PWM units for timing and control
- Analog-to-Digital Converter (ADC) for sensor interfacing
- Serial communication interfaces (UART, SPI, CAN)
- Interrupt controller for efficient interrupt handling
- Watchdog timer for system monitoring

Additional Details
The SAK-C167CS-L33M CA is designed for use in embedded systems requiring real-time performance. The integrated CAN interface allows for robust communication with other devices in industrial networks. The microcontroller's architecture supports a wide range of applications requiring precise control and timing. The integrated peripherals, such as timers, PWM units, and ADC, reduce the need for external components, simplifying system design and reducing overall cost. The watchdog timer ensures reliable system operation by detecting and recovering from software errors. It is supported by Infineon's development tools, including compilers, debuggers, and emulators, which facilitate software development and debugging. The operating voltage for the device is typically 5V. This microcontroller provides a balance of performance, integration, and reliability for a wide range of embedded control applications.
